Transition From Blueprint to Reality: The Power of 3D Architectural Models

Architects commonly relied on sketches to communicate their designs. However, the advent of 3D architectural models has transformed the way we plan buildings. These digital representations provide a interactive platform for architects to visualize their projects in a more accurate manner.

3D models offer a spectrum of advantages. Clients can simply understand complex designs, pinpointing potential problems at an early stage. Architects can refine their designs seamlessly, incorporating client feedback. The result is a harmonious process that leads to more successful buildings.

Popular 3D Architectural Modeling Software: A Comparative Analysis

Within the realm of architectural design, 3D modeling software has emerged as an indispensable tool. From conceptualization to construction documentation, these applications empower architects and designers to visualize and manipulate structures in a virtual environment. This comparative analysis delves into some of the widely used 3D architectural modeling software solutions currently available, exploring their features, strengths, and limitations.

Architects today have a plethora of options at their disposal, ranging from industry-standard platforms like Autodesk Revit and SketchUp to more specialized applications such as Rhino 3D and Vectorworks Architect. Each software package boasts a unique set of capabilities, catering to diverse project requirements and user preferences.

  • Autodesk Revit is renowned for its comprehensive building information modeling (BIM) capabilities, enabling architects to create detailed models that incorporate structural, mechanical, electrical, and plumbing systems.
  • SketchUp's intuitive interface and ease of use have made it a favorite among hobbyists and professionals alike. Its extensive library of 3D models further simplifies the design process.
  • Rhino 3D is celebrated for its advanced modeling tools and ability to handle complex geometries, making it well-suited for parametric design and organic forms.

Selecting the optimal software depends on factors such as project scope, budget constraints, and individual user expertise.
